gpt4 book ai didi

sql - excel ace.oledb vba 连接到 csv 只返回第一列

转载 作者:行者123 更新时间:2023-12-04 21:46:02 25 4
gpt4 key购买 nike

在 VBA Excel (Office 365) 中使用像 "Provider=Microsoft.ACE.OLEDB.12.0;data source=..." 这样的连接字符串并使用命令字符串 SELECT * FROM [text;HDR=Yes;FMT=Delimited;Delimiter=';';database=KKS].[kks.csv];结果是:
enter image description here当 CSV 源文件如下所示时:

rng;key;component;
"0";"A";"Grid and distribution systems";
"0";"B";"Power transmission and auxiliary power supply";
schema.ini是:
[kks.csv]
ColNameHeader=True
Format=CSVDelimited
Decimalsymbol=(,)
Delimiter=(;)
我已经尝试了连接字符串和 schema.ini 的任何组合(也完全删除它),结果充其量是相同的。有什么建议吗?谢谢!

最佳答案

如下更改 Schema.ini。

[kks.csv]
Format = Delimited(;)

关于sql - excel ace.oledb vba 连接到 csv 只返回第一列,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/65845703/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com